professionals and patients.*Job Description*The Case Manager is a
qualified registered nurse with the ability to provide and oversee
the care of assigned patients and associated staff in accordance
with physician orders and the plan of care per state Practice Act.
In this role, you will report to the Director of Nursing/Director
of Patient Care Services/Clinical Supervisor/Nursing
Supervisor/Clinical Manager.*Duties/Responsibilities:** Develops,
delivers/implements, revises, and evaluates individualized
patient-centered care plans under the supervision of a physician*
Provides case management to an assigned group of patients and
ancillary staff* Understands and submits required data collection
sets (OASIS, PAR, etc.) and other documentation as requested by the
state and/or, federal government and insurance payers within
required timeframes* Makes the initial evaluation visit and
regularly reevaluates the patient's nursing needs per state and
payor requirements* Acts as an advocate for patient welfare and
coordinates care between patients, their families/caregivers and/or
their authorized representative, the agency and other healthcare
providers/facilities/ outside agencies* Furnishes those services
requiring substantial specialized nursing skill according to
competency level* Demonstrates problem solving abilities and
positive interpersonal communication skills* Identifies care
preferences of patients and verifies that interventions meet the
patient's needs and their goals of treatment* Initiates appropriate
preventive and rehabilitative nursing procedures* Prepares clinical
and progress notes for each patient visit and summaries* Attends
case conferences as assigned* Informs physician and other personnel
of changes in the patient's condition and needs* Counsels the
patient and family/significant others in meeting nursing and
related needs. Educates on the proper home health strategies and
procedures utilizing community resources as applicable* Observes
and reports patient symptoms, reaction to treatments, drugs and
changes in the patient's physical or emotional condition,
responsible for medication reconciliation* Participates in
in-service programs, supervising and teaching other nursing
personnel as assigned* Administers medication per agency policy and
physician orders* Provides written instructions for aides or other
ancillary disciplines caring for the patient* Processes orders and
notifies physician of patient needs and changes in condition*
Refers cases with physician's orders to Physical Therapist, Speech
Language Pathologist, Occupational Therapist and Medical Social
Worker for those patients requiring their specialized skills*
Understands and adheres to the Policy/Procedure, Best Practices,
Infection Control Plan, EMS Plan, and the Compliance Plan*
Participates in clinical record/utilization review of medical
records and quality assurance and performance improvement (QAPI)
quarterly and as assigned. Reports/records all applicable
infections, occurrences, and complaints* Submits documentation
within 24 hours or per state requirements* Maintains
confidentiality of patient, employee, and agency matters* Takes
on-call duty nights, weekends, and holidays, as assigned. When
functioning as the on-call RN acts as the after-hours supervising
nurse and makes nursing assessment and triage decisions under the
guidance of the overall Clinical Supervisor as applicable*
Immediately reports to Nursing Supervisor any patient
incidents/variances or complaints* Demonstrates competent
performance of technical skills according to established
procedures* Maintains acceptable attendance status, per Agency
policy* Reports all incomplete work assignments to Nursing
Supervisor* Demonstrates effective time management skills through
daily documentation and infrequent overtime for routine
assignments* Ensures that the following information/instruction is
given in writing to the patient/caregiver/representative: visit
schedule with frequency of visits, complete medication profile, any
treatments to be administered by agency staff (POC), any other
pertinent instruction related to the patient's care needs, name and
contact information of the agency's Clinical Manager* Performs all
other duties as assigned*Required Skills/Abilities/Knowledge:**
